WebThe amount of notice you are entitled to by law depends on how long you have been working for your employer. Duration of employment. Minimum notice. 13 weeks to 2 years. 1 week. 2 years to 5 years. 2 weeks. 5 years to 10 years. 4 weeks. WebWhen an employee is paid money that he or she would have earned through working during the contracted period because he or she is being terminated without notice, it is called wages in lieu of notice. A contractual period for notice may be included as a term in an implied or express contract. Express contracts can be oral or written.

WebMay 28, 2024 · When an employee is terminated without cause, they may be entitled to “pay in lieu of notice”. This means that the employer will pay the employee their regular salary for the period of time that they would have normally been given notice. Anyone legally classed as an employee must be paid as normal for any time they work during their notice period. If an employee is off work during their notice period, the amount they're paid will depend on the type of notice they have.
